/freebsd-10.0-release/contrib/llvm/lib/Target/R600/ |
H A D | AMDGPUMCInstLower.cpp | 44 const APFloat &FloatValue = MO.getFPImm()->getValueAPF();
|
H A D | AMDGPUISelLowering.cpp | 364 return CFP->getValueAPF().isZero();
|
/freebsd-10.0-release/contrib/llvm/lib/Target/ARM/ |
H A D | ARMMCInstLower.cpp | 101 APFloat Val = MO.getFPImm()->getValueAPF();
|
/freebsd-10.0-release/contrib/llvm/lib/Target/Hexagon/ |
H A D | HexagonMCInstLower.cpp | 61 APFloat Val = MO.getFPImm()->getValueAPF();
|
/freebsd-10.0-release/contrib/llvm/lib/Transforms/InstCombine/ |
H A D | InstCombineSelect.cpp | 807 !CFPt->getValueAPF().isZero()) || 809 !CFPf->getValueAPF().isZero())) 819 !CFPt->getValueAPF().isZero()) || 821 !CFPf->getValueAPF().isZero())) 834 !CFPt->getValueAPF().isZero()) || 836 !CFPf->getValueAPF().isZero())) 846 !CFPt->getValueAPF().isZero()) || 848 !CFPf->getValueAPF().isZero()))
|
H A D | InstCombineMulDivRem.cpp | 309 return (C0 && C0->getValueAPF().isNormal()) || 310 (C1 && C1->getValueAPF().isNormal()); 314 const APFloat &Flt = C->getValueAPF(); 394 if (C && AllowReassociate && C->getValueAPF().isNormal()) { 421 if (C1 && C1->getValueAPF().isNormal() && 855 const APFloat &FpVal = Divisor->getValueAPF(); 893 const APFloat &F = cast<ConstantFP>(C)->getValueAPF(); 900 const APFloat &F = cast<ConstantFP>(C)->getValueAPF(); 941 const APFloat &FoldC = cast<ConstantFP>(Fold)->getValueAPF();
|
H A D | InstCombineAddSub.cpp | 126 { Coeff.set(Coefficient->getValueAPF()); Val = V; } 387 Addend0.set(APFloat(C0->getValueAPF().getSemantics()), 0); 490 const APFloat &F = CFP->getValueAPF();
|
/freebsd-10.0-release/contrib/llvm/lib/Analysis/ |
H A D | ConstantFolding.cpp | 1281 APFloat Val(Op->getValueAPF()); 1297 if (Op->getValueAPF().isNaN() || Op->getValueAPF().isInfinity()) 1306 V = Op->getValueAPF().convertToFloat(); 1308 V = Op->getValueAPF().convertToDouble(); 1311 APFloat APF = Op->getValueAPF(); 1453 return ConstantFoldConvertToInt(FPOp->getValueAPF(), 1461 return ConstantFoldConvertToInt(FPOp->getValueAPF(), 1481 Op1V = Op1->getValueAPF().convertToFloat(); 1483 Op1V = Op1->getValueAPF() [all...] |
/freebsd-10.0-release/contrib/llvm/lib/CodeGen/SelectionDAG/ |
H A D | SelectionDAGDumper.cpp | 376 if (&CSDN->getValueAPF().getSemantics()==&APFloat::IEEEsingle) 377 OS << '<' << CSDN->getValueAPF().convertToFloat() << '>'; 378 else if (&CSDN->getValueAPF().getSemantics()==&APFloat::IEEEdouble) 379 OS << '<' << CSDN->getValueAPF().convertToDouble() << '>'; 382 CSDN->getValueAPF().bitcastToAPInt().dump();
|
H A D | SelectionDAG.cpp | 76 return getValueAPF().bitwiseIsEqual(V); 128 if (CFPN->getValueAPF().bitcastToAPInt().countTrailingOnes() < EltSize) 169 if (!CFPN->getValueAPF().isPosZero()) 1603 APFloat::cmpResult R = N1C->getValueAPF().compare(N2C->getValueAPF()); 2367 return !C->getValueAPF().isNaN(); 2466 APFloat V = C->getValueAPF(); // make copy 2869 if (CFP->getValueAPF().isZero()) 2873 if (CFP->getValueAPF().isZero()) 2878 if (CFP->getValueAPF() [all...] |
/freebsd-10.0-release/contrib/llvm/lib/Target/MBlaze/ |
H A D | MBlazeMCInstLower.cpp | 153 APFloat FVal = MO.getFPImm()->getValueAPF();
|
H A D | MBlazeAsmPrinter.cpp | 230 printHex32(fp->getValueAPF().bitcastToAPInt().getZExtValue(), O);
|
/freebsd-10.0-release/contrib/llvm/lib/IR/ |
H A D | AsmWriter.cpp | 806 if (&CFP->getValueAPF().getSemantics() == &APFloat::IEEEsingle || 807 &CFP->getValueAPF().getSemantics() == &APFloat::IEEEdouble) { 814 bool isHalf = &CFP->getValueAPF().getSemantics()==&APFloat::IEEEhalf; 815 bool isDouble = &CFP->getValueAPF().getSemantics()==&APFloat::IEEEdouble; 816 bool isInf = CFP->getValueAPF().isInfinity(); 817 bool isNaN = CFP->getValueAPF().isNaN(); 819 double Val = isDouble ? CFP->getValueAPF().convertToDouble() : 820 CFP->getValueAPF().convertToFloat(); 845 APFloat apf = CFP->getValueAPF(); 863 if (&CFP->getValueAPF() [all...] |
H A D | Metadata.cpp | 410 APFloat AVal = cast<ConstantFP>(A->getOperand(0))->getValueAPF(); 411 APFloat BVal = cast<ConstantFP>(B->getOperand(0))->getValueAPF();
|
H A D | ConstantFold.cpp | 181 FP->getValueAPF().bitcastToAPInt()); 573 APFloat Val = FPC->getValueAPF(); 588 const APFloat &V = FPC->getValueAPF(); 1112 APFloat C1V = CFP1->getValueAPF(); 1113 APFloat C2V = CFP2->getValueAPF(); 1651 APFloat C1V = cast<ConstantFP>(C1)->getValueAPF(); 1652 APFloat C2V = cast<ConstantFP>(C2)->getValueAPF();
|
H A D | Constants.cpp | 95 return CFP->getValueAPF().bitcastToAPInt().isAllOnesValue(); 590 APFloat apf = cast<ConstantFP>(Constant::getNullValue(Ty))->getValueAPF(); 819 Elts.push_back(CFP->getValueAPF().convertToFloat()); 828 Elts.push_back(CFP->getValueAPF().convertToDouble()); 1000 Elts.push_back(CFP->getValueAPF().convertToFloat()); 1009 Elts.push_back(CFP->getValueAPF().convertToDouble()); 2403 SmallVector<float, 16> Elts(NumElts, CFP->getValueAPF().convertToFloat()); 2408 CFP->getValueAPF().convertToDouble());
|
/freebsd-10.0-release/contrib/llvm/lib/Target/AArch64/ |
H A D | AArch64ISelDAGToDAG.cpp | 134 CN->getValueAPF().convertToInteger(IntVal, APFloat::rmTowardZero, &IsExact); 170 if (!Imm || !Imm->getValueAPF().isPosZero()) 525 if (A64Imms::isFPImm(cast<ConstantFPSDNode>(Node)->getValueAPF())) {
|
/freebsd-10.0-release/contrib/llvm/lib/ExecutionEngine/ |
H A D | ExecutionEngine.cpp | 813 Result.FloatVal = cast<ConstantFP>(C)->getValueAPF().convertToFloat(); 816 Result.DoubleVal = cast<ConstantFP>(C)->getValueAPF().convertToDouble(); 821 Result.IntVal = cast <ConstantFP>(C)->getValueAPF().bitcastToAPInt(); 871 CV->getOperand(i))->getValueAPF().convertToFloat(); 893 CV->getOperand(i))->getValueAPF().convertToDouble();
|
/freebsd-10.0-release/contrib/llvm/include/llvm/CodeGen/ |
H A D | SelectionDAGNodes.h | 1188 const APFloat& getValueAPF() const { return Value->getValueAPF(); } function in class:llvm::SDNode::ConstantFPSDNode 1208 Tmp.convert(Value->getValueAPF().getSemantics(),
|
/freebsd-10.0-release/contrib/llvm/lib/Target/NVPTX/ |
H A D | NVPTXAsmPrinter.cpp | 1759 APFloat APF = APFloat(Fp->getValueAPF()); // make a copy 1893 float float32 = (float) CFP->getValueAPF().convertToFloat(); 1897 double float64 = CFP->getValueAPF().convertToDouble();
|
/freebsd-10.0-release/contrib/llvm/lib/Transforms/Scalar/ |
H A D | IndVarSimplify.cpp | 250 if (!InitValueVal || !ConvertToSInt(InitValueVal->getValueAPF(), InitValue)) 264 !ConvertToSInt(IncValueVal->getValueAPF(), IncValue)) 302 !ConvertToSInt(ExitValueVal->getValueAPF(), ExitValue))
|
/freebsd-10.0-release/contrib/llvm/lib/Target/CppBackend/ |
H A D | CPPBackend.cpp | 217 APFloat APF = APFloat(CFP->getValueAPF()); // copy 236 std::string StrVal = ftostr(CFP->getValueAPF()); 253 << utohexstr(CFP->getValueAPF().bitcastToAPInt().getZExtValue()) 257 << utohexstr((uint32_t)CFP->getValueAPF().
|
/freebsd-10.0-release/contrib/llvm/lib/Bitcode/Writer/ |
H A D | BitcodeWriter.cpp | 899 Record.push_back(CFP->getValueAPF().bitcastToAPInt().getZExtValue()); 903 APInt api = CFP->getValueAPF().bitcastToAPInt(); 908 APInt api = CFP->getValueAPF().bitcastToAPInt();
|
/freebsd-10.0-release/contrib/llvm/lib/CodeGen/AsmPrinter/ |
H A D | AsmPrinter.cpp | 571 APFloat APF = APFloat(MI->getOperand(0).getFPImm()->getValueAPF()); 1750 APInt API = CFP->getValueAPF().bitcastToAPInt(); 1756 CFP->getValueAPF().toString(StrVal);
|
H A D | DwarfCompileUnit.cpp | 613 APFloat FPImm = MO.getFPImm()->getValueAPF(); 636 return addConstantValue(Die, CFP->getValueAPF().bitcastToAPInt(), false);
|